FIRE SPRINKLERS: Automatic fire sprinklers shall be installed in all occupancies in accordance <br /> with the 2016 Pleasanton Building, Fire and Residential Codes with local amendments and <br /> ordinances. <br /> 47. PREMISES IDENTIFICATION: Address numbers shall be installed on the front or primary <br /> entrance for all buildings. Minimum building address character size shall be 12-inch high by 1- <br /> inch stroke. In all cases address numerals shall be of contrasting background and clearly visible <br /> in accordance with the Livermore-Pleasanton Fire Department Premises Identification <br /> Standards. This may warrant field verification and adjustments based upon topography, <br /> landscaping or other obstructions. <br /> P19-0092 Planning Commission <br /> Page 7 of 9 <br /> Planning Commission <br /> Page 4 of 9 <br />
